Hello all,

Just for your information, the "scam" is still on. My wife received the same phone call and being told the same thing about having won prizes blah blah blah. As usual, we were asked to attend a 2-hour session on 18 Dec 05 evening before we can claim the prizes. I am very glad that there is this website with which we can be informed, before we make the mistake of attending the session.

Legally, it is not a scam per se because they will give you stuff, vs nothing at all. However, what is unacceptable is how they "market" the whole set-up. They are operating within the bounds of law but at the same time use loopholes in the same law to achieve their ends.

The best response is NOT to attend or even entertain them.
